Medical Examination Overview 🩺

After successfully clearing the Computer-Based Tests (CBTs), candidates undergo a medical fitness test conducted by the Railway Administration. This examination ensures that aspirants are medically fit to perform the duties associated with the technician roles. The medical test evaluates various health parameters, including vision, hearing, and overall physical fitness.

Visual Acuity Standards 👁️

Visual acuity is a critical component of the medical examination. The standards vary based on the specific technician category:

  • Category A-1: Requires 6/6 vision in both eyes without glasses. Candidates must not have color blindness.
  • Category B-1: Requires 6/9 vision with or without glasses. Near vision should be 0.6/0.6 with or without glasses, and candidates must pass tests for color vision, binocular vision, and night vision.
  • Category C-1: Requires 6/12, 6/18 vision with or without glasses. Near vision should be 0.6/0.6 with or without glasses.

Hearing Ability Requirements 👂

Clear hearing is vital for safety in railway operations. Candidates should be able to:

  • Hear a forced whisper at a distance of 5 meters in a quiet room.
  • Have no history of progressive hearing loss or conditions that could impair hearing.

Physical Fitness and General Health 🏃

Beyond vision and hearing, candidates must exhibit overall physical fitness:

  • Locomotor Functions: Full functionality of limbs and joints to perform tasks efficiently.
  • Absence of Medical Conditions: No history of ailments like epilepsy, psychiatric disorders, or any condition that could hinder safe working practices.

Potential Disqualification Factors 🚫

Certain medical conditions can lead to disqualification:

  • Color Blindness: Especially critical for categories requiring color differentiation.
  • Chronic Diseases: Such as uncontrolled diabetes or hypertension.
  • Physical Disabilities: That impede the performance of essential job functions.

Candidates are advised to undergo a preliminary medical check-up to identify and address potential disqualifying conditions.

Preparation Tips for the Medical Test 📝

To enhance the chances of clearing the medical examination:

  • Regular Eye Check-ups: Ensure vision meets the required standards. Address issues like refractive errors in advance.
  • Maintain Physical Fitness: Engage in regular exercise and a balanced diet to keep health parameters in check.
  • Hearing Assessments: Periodically test hearing ability and avoid exposure to loud noises.
  • Medical Consultations: Seek advice from healthcare professionals regarding any existing health conditions.
